Question: How Do You Cook Dried Rice Noodles?

question: how do you cook dried rice noodles?

1. Bring a large pot of water to a boil, adding a pinch of salt to the water.

2. Add the dried rice noodles to the boiling water and stir gently.

3. Cook the noodles according to the package directions, stirring occasionally.

4. Once the noodles are cooked, drain them in a colander and rinse them with cold water.

5. Serve the noodles immediately or store them in the refrigerator for later use.

Here are some optional steps you can take to enhance the flavor of your rice noodles:

* Add a tablespoon of oil to the boiling water before adding the noodles. This will help prevent the noodles from sticking together.
* Add some aromatics to the boiling water, such as ginger, garlic, or lemongrass. This will infuse the noodles with flavor.
* Once the noodles are cooked, toss them with a sauce of your choice. Some popular sauces include soy sauce, oyster sauce, or peanut sauce.
* Add some vegetables or protein to the noodles to make a complete meal. Some popular additions include chicken, shrimp, broccoli, or carrots.

do you have to soak rice noodles before cooking?

Do you have to soak rice noodles before cooking? Yes, soaking rice noodles before cooking is a crucial step that ensures they soften and cook evenly. The soaking process hydrates the noodles, making them pliable and easier to work with. It also helps to remove any excess starch, resulting in a better texture and preventing the noodles from becoming sticky. Depending on the type of rice noodles, the soaking time can vary from a few minutes to several hours. For example, thin vermicelli noodles may only require a brief soak of 10-15 minutes, while thicker flat noodles may need up to an hour or more. Always refer to the package instructions for specific soaking times and cooking methods. Once the noodles are sufficiently soaked, drain them thoroughly before cooking. This helps to prevent the noodles from becoming mushy and ensures that they cook evenly.

how long do you cook dry rice noodles?

Dry rice noodles, a staple ingredient in many Asian cuisines, are known for their delicate texture and mild flavor. Cooking these noodles is a simple process that requires careful attention to time and technique. To achieve the perfect al dente texture, it’s important not to overcook them. Bring a large pot of water to a boil, season it with salt, and add the rice noodles. Stir gently to separate the noodles and prevent them from sticking together. Depending on the thickness of the noodles, cooking time can vary. For thin rice noodles, 3-4 minutes of boiling is generally sufficient, while thicker noodles may require 5-7 minutes. Keep a close eye on the noodles and taste them regularly to ensure they have reached the desired tenderness. Once cooked, drain the noodles in a colander and rinse them with cold water to stop the cooking process. Dry rice noodles can be enjoyed in a variety of dishes, from stir-fries to noodle soups and salads, and their versatility makes them a popular choice among home cooks and restaurant chefs alike.

how do you rehydrate dried rice noodles?

Soak the dried rice noodles in a large bowl of warm water. Let them soak for 30 minutes, or until they are softened and pliable. Drain the noodles in a colander and rinse them with cold water.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Add the noodles and cook them according to the package directions. Once the noodles are cooked, drain them in a colander and rinse them with cold water.Serve the noodles immediately or store them in the refrigerator for later use.

do you boil rice noodles?

Rice noodles are delicious and commonly used in various cuisines around the world. If you’re cooking rice noodles, you might wonder if boiling is the right method. The answer is yes, you should boil rice noodles to achieve the best texture and flavor. To boil rice noodles, start by bringing a large pot of water to a boil. Add the rice noodles and stir to ensure they are separated. Cook the noodles for the time specified on the packaging, stirring occasionally to prevent them from sticking together. Once the noodles are cooked, drain them in a colander and rinse with cold water. You can then use the cooked rice noodles in your favorite dishes like stir-fries, soups, or salads.
